Create and Manage Application Instances
For CASB, to differentiate between corporate and non-corporate SaaS application instances, administrators need to configure access policies using the instance parameter.
-
To identify an instance, CASB requires the instance ID, the instance domain, and the instance type.
-
To monitor logs, the instance tags are used. Tags indicate whether the application instance is sanctioned by your organization.
Each application can have its own instance ID.
